Thursday: Boyzone at Irish Village

Legendary Irish boyband Boyzone will perform at Dubai Duty Free Tennis Stadium on Friday April 12. The four-piece boyband enjoyed more than 25 successful years in the music industry, racking up plenty of number ones. Ronan Keating, Shane Lynch, Mikey Graham and Keith Duffy parted ways back in 2000 after seven years together but reunited in 2009 and again 2013 to celebrate their 20th anniversary with a tour and new music. This is set to be your last chance to see the boyband, who announced last year that they are splitting up for good after their farewell tour in 2019.

Friday: Space Ibiza at Blue Marlin Ibiza UAE

For the first time ever, Space Ibiza will be doing a takeover at the famed Blue Marlin Ibiza UAE on Friday April 12. The day-to-night party spot will see Kerri Chandler headline. Described as one of deep house music’s originators, Kerri Chandler has been spinning soul into his sets since the early 90s and is now widely regarded as one of the most respected house music producers around. The Space Ibiza takeover will also welcome sets from Frank Wiedemann, as well as local support from Marco Loco, Frederick Stone and Michka. Doors will open from 1pm for those wishing to top up their tans before the DJs spin.
